FacilitiesThere’s nothing more inspiring than having top-notch facilities at your disposal. As a modern university, we’ve invested in the best to enhance the student experience. Our new, purpose built Watersports Centre is located at our Warsash campus at the mouth of the River Hamble.

In addition to its degree-level courses, the Outdoor and Events programme delivers practical, internationally recognised qualifications in navigation, dinghy and keelboat sailing, powerboating and kayaking at the Centre, which is Royal Yachting Association (RYA) and British Canoe Union (BCU) accredited. The University’s student sailing club also uses these facilities for recreational sailing, race training and selection.
